There was a chance of sun for the first couple of hours but nothing came of it. I spent most of the morning at a location east of Etzelwang that I’d previously spotted from the train. Walking to the position from the road it dawned on me that it was a spot I’d used in 1985 but the good part of it had become very overgrown in the intervening 27 years, leaving only a short, and not very good, section clear.

The freight I was expecting didn’t show but three that I wasn’t expecting did, including a fairly anonymous orange MAK G1206 on a train of swap bodies. It did have a UIC number on the fuel tank but the only bit that registered was 511 (some detective work required). A few days ago a local gricer had mentioned trains being diverted away from Pegnitztal today and running via Weiden and Neukirchen but there was nothing on Max’s Moleworks list to indicate any changes, so I’d dismissed it. However, it might only have been freights that were diverted, which would, at least explain the two Ludmillas on westbounds. The car train seen was not the regular lunchtime working conveying Peugeots and Citroens from Kolin, this one was all VWs.

By 11:00 it had started to rain, as forecast, so I set off westwards to my base for the last few days of the trip, Walluf, on the outskirts of Wiesbaden. The Penzion I had booked was called the Lok Inn but it didn’t occur to me that it might have a railway connection until I tapped the address into the satnav. It was the Bahnhofstraße bit that gave the game away. Turns out it’s not just in Bahnhofstraße, it is the Bahnhof, Niederwalluf Bahnhof on the Rechte Rheinstrecke to be precise, converted into very comfortable accomodation. I can see the trains from my window but the platform canopy makes it all but impossible to see the numbers. That’s probably a good thing as it will force me to go out, at least when it stops raining.
